Harlan kept a clean sheet against Taft on Friday. They walked away with a 2-0 win over the Taft Raiders. The Hawks' defense has been rock solid lately; the team hasn't given up a goal in their last four games.
Bryan Turcios and Josh Olivares scored both of Harlan's goals, bringing their combined season tally to five goals.
Harlan's victory bumped their record up to 6-4-1. As for Taft, they are on a four-game losing streak that has dropped them down to 6-9.
Harlan will welcome Warren at 5:00 p.m. on Wednesday. Warren will roll in looking for their eighth straight win, something Harlan surely won't give up without a fight. Taft has already played their next matchup (against Brennan), but no score has been uploaded at the time of writing.
